Redis集群的硬件优化性能提升(redis 集群 硬件)
随着数据和计算量的增加,硬件性能对于Redis集群来说至关重要。几年前,Redis在单机环境下可以满足很多需求,但是随着数据增长,计算量也增加,而且服务器的性能并不能很好地支撑起Redis的工作负载,因此,Redis集群的架构就意味着同时挂载多台服务器来实现有效的分布式计算。
硬件优化可以用于改进Redis集群的性能。一般情况下,可以通过增加集群的可用内存和节点,减少节点间的通信代价和网络开销,优化Redis的存储机制,以及优化硬件资源来实现此目的。
可以增加集群中机器的内存和系统配置,以确保每台服务器上的Redis服务器正常运行,也可以减少节点间的间接通信开销和网络开销。此外,可以结合容量密集型存储机制优化集群的性能,并使用SSD存储技术取代硬盘,以提高Redis的速度。
可以优化硬件资源,如内存,缓存,处理器,CPU时钟频率,以及主板等。在内存资源方面,应该考虑使用多模内存条,最大限度地提高内存读取速度。若要优化缓存,则应考虑将多个字节块缓存到内存,而不是仅仅缓存一行或一列数据,以实现更快的访问速度和更高的延迟。
此外,可以在进行硬件优化时考虑使用哈希索引算法来优化Redis的查询,并使用多层次索引来解决一些复杂的查找问题。可以考虑使用多个线程和多核处理器来加速Redis的访问速度和处理能力。